The Universal Language of Hello: Understanding Global Greetings 🌎
- Handshakes dominate Western business culture, serving as a vital element of professional interactions. Interestingly, during my time in the United States, I noticed one thing. A firm handshake sets the tone for future conversations. Have you experienced a similar situation? Common greetings in different cultures may include a handshake, but each varies in style.
- Bowing remains central in many Asian societies, conveying respect and acknowledgment. In Japan, for instance, I learned the significance of the depth of the bow depending on the relationship. Have you ever had a memorable bowing experience? Bowing across the globe is one of the worldwide greetings that signify respect.
- The hongi (nose pressing) in Maori culture symbolizes sharing breath and life force. Participating in this ritual during my visit to New Zealand was a profound experience. What cultural rituals have you encountered that struck you deeply? Hongi shares its essence with other common greetings worldwide, promoting unity.
- Middle Eastern cultures often emphasize right-hand gestures and verbal greetings which are integral to their customs. For example, offering your right hand when greeting someone is essential.
